Recipe View Preheat & Prepare: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). (5 minutes) Grease a 9x13-inch baking dish. Line the dish with aluminum foil, leaving an overhang on all sides for easy removal. Grease the foil as well.

Image Step 02
02 Step

Recipe View Craft the Crust: In a medium bowl, whisk together 2 cups sifted all-purpose flour, 1 cup confectioners' sugar, and 1 tablespoon lemon zest. Cut in the softened butter using a pastry blender or your fingertips until the mixture resembles fine crumbs. Press the mixture evenly into the bottom of the prepared baking dish. (10 minutes)

Image Step 03
03 Step

Recipe View Bake the Crust: Bake in the preheated oven until the crust is lightly golden brown, approximately 15-20 minutes. (20 minutes)

Image Step 04
04 Step

Recipe View Whisk the Eggs: While the crust is baking, in a large bowl or the bowl of a stand mixer, beat the eggs until they are light in color. (5 minutes)

Image Step 05
05 Step

Recipe View Blend Filling: In a separate bowl, whisk together the granulated sugar, 1/4 cup flour, and baking powder until well combined and no lumps remain. Gradually beat this mixture into the eggs until fully incorporated. Stir in the lemon juice and remaining 1 tablespoon lemon zest. (5 minutes)

Image Step 06
06 Step

Recipe View Pour & Bake: Pour the lemon filling evenly over the pre-baked crust. Bake in the preheated oven for about 25 minutes, or until the filling is set in the middle and the edges are slightly golden. (25 minutes)

Image Step 07
07 Step

Recipe View Cool & Dust: Let the pastry cool in the pan until just warm to the touch. Dust generously with confectioners' sugar. Allow to cool completely. (30 minutes)

Image Step 08
08 Step

Recipe View Chill & Cut: Using the foil overhang, carefully lift the pastry from the pan. Refrigerate until slightly firmed for easier cutting. Cut into 2-inch squares, then halve each square diagonally to create triangles. (10 minutes)

For an extra burst of lemon flavor, try adding a teaspoon of lemon extract to the filling.
Make sure your butter is softened properly for the crust to come together easily.
Don't overbake the bars! The filling should be set but still have a slight jiggle.
For clean cuts, use a warm, wet knife when cutting the chilled bars.
